新闻中心 - 直击软件开发第一现场,掌握全球化的消息 -
首页 > 新闻中心 > 小程序开发资料
小程序组件开发,小程序开发示例

标题:小程序 组件 开发实例

随着移动互联网的快速发展,各种移动应用也成为了人们生活中不可或缺的一部分。而随着微信小程序的兴起,越来越多的开发者开始进入小程序开发的领域。在小程序的开发过程中,组件是非常重要的一部分,它可以帮助开发者更加高效地开发小程序,提升用户体验。本文将介绍小程序组件的开发实例,帮助开发者更好地掌握小程序开发技术。

一、 背景介绍

微信小程序是微信推出的一种新的应用形态,用户可以在不安装应用的情况下直接使用。小程序采用组件化开发的思路,开发者可以将页面拆分为一个个独立的组件,然后再把这些组件组合起来形成页面。通过组件化开发,开发者可以提高代码的复用性,降低维护成本,提升开发效率。

二、 小程序组件开发实例

1. 列表组件开发

在小程序中,列表是非常常见的组件,比如商品列表、新闻列表等。为了提高开发效率,开发者可以封装一个通用的列表组件,在需要使用列表的页面直接引入该组件即可。在开发过程中,需要考虑组件的可定制性,比如支持下拉刷新、上拉加载更多、列表项的可点击等功能。

2. 表单组件开发

表单是小程序中常用的组件,比如登录表单、注册表单等。为了提高代码的复用性,开发者可以封装一个通用的表单组件,供各个页面直接引用。在开发过程中,需要考虑到表单的验证、提交等功能,以及表单元素的可定制性,比如输入框的类型、输入框的提示文字等。

3. 对话框组件开发

对话框是小程序中常用的弹窗组件,比如确认对话框、提示对话框等。为了提高开发效率,开发者可以封装一个通用的对话框组件,在需要使用对话框的地方直接引入该组件即可。在开发过程中,需要考虑到对话框的定制性,比如对话框的样式、标题、内容等。

4. 图片轮播组件开发

图片轮播是小程序中常用的组件,比如广告轮播、产品轮播等。为了提高开发效率,开发者可以封装一个通用的图片轮播组件,在需要使用轮播的地方直接引入该组件即可。在开发过程中,需要考虑到轮播的定制性,比如轮播的播放时长、轮播的切换效果、轮播的内容等。

三、 小程序组件开发的优势

1. 提高开发效率

通过组件化开发,可以将页面拆分为一个个独立的组件,开发者可以复用已开发的组件,提高开发效率。

2. 提升用户体验

通过组件化开发,可以提高页面的稳定性和性能,能够更好地提升用户体验。

3. 降低维护成本

通过组件化开发,可以降低代码的耦合度,降低维护成本,提高代码的可维护性。

四、 结语

小程序组件开发是小程序开发的重要一环,通过组件化开发,可以提高开发效率,提升用户体验,降低维护成本。在实际开发中,开发者需要根据项目实际需求,灵活运用组件化开发的思想,开发出符合用户需求的小程序。希望本文对小程序开发者有所帮助,更好地掌握小程序组件开发技术。